基于Globus Toolkit 4的网格服务研究开发

基于Globus Toolkit 4的网格服务研究开发

论文摘要

随着服务需求的不断发展,单台高性能计算机已经不能胜任一些超大规模需求问题的解决。利用网格技术能够实现各种资源的全面共享与连通。目前,Web服务技术和网格技术是两个研究热点,通过结合最新的Web服务技术和网格技术,形成了新一代的网格体系结构OGSA(Open Grid Services Architecture)。基于OGSA的网格服务通过提供一组遵守特定约定的定义明确的接口,能够实现信息、资源和应用的融合与共享。作者分析了Globus Toolkit 4中的单资源模式服务、多资源工厂模式服务和端点引用管理等;在与单资源设计模式作对比的基础上,采用多资源工厂模式研究了数学计算网格服务的开发流程;开发了单只股票报价网格服务,并在此基础上使用多资源工厂模式实现了股票组合管理网格服务。论文在介绍网格服务相关概念和技术的基础上,采用开源的网格基础平台GlobusToolkit 4构建了网格试验环境;针对基于Globus Toolkit 4的网格服务的实现问题,介绍了单资源模式服务、多资源工厂模式服务的实现模型,并以一个网格数学计算为例,详细说明了多资源工厂模式网格服务的实现过程;为了缓解证券公司股票行情服务器在行情火爆的时候性能无法承受大流量的数据访问的问题,设计了以网格中间件Globus Toolkit 4为基础的股票报价网格服务应用系统,以该系统为支撑,分别实现了单只股票报价网格服务和多资源工厂模式的股票组合管理网格服务。论文验证了基于Globus Toolkit 4网格服务的可行性和优越性,为网格服务的进一步应用奠定了基础。

论文目录

  • 摘要
  • Abstract
  • 1 绪论
  • 1.1 课题研究背景
  • 1.1.1 网格的发展与研究背景
  • 1.1.2 研究本课题的意义
  • 1.2 国内外研究现状
  • 1.2.1 国外研究现状
  • 1.2.2 国内研究现状
  • 1.3 课题主要研究内容
  • 1.4 本章小结
  • 2 相关理论和技术
  • 2.1 网格服务
  • 2.1.1 网格服务概念
  • 2.1.2 网格服务语言
  • 2.2 网格体系结构
  • 2.2.1 开放网格服务体系结构OGSA
  • 2.2.2 网络服务资源框架WSRF
  • 2.3 Globus和Globus Toolkit
  • 2.3.1 Globus资源分配管理
  • 2.3.2 监控和发现服务
  • 2.3.3 网格文件传输服务
  • 2.3.4 资源调度服务
  • 2.4 本章小结
  • 3 基于Globus Toolkit 4的网格环境构建
  • 3.1 Windows和Linux系统下网格环境构建
  • 3.1.1 Windows下网格环境配置
  • 3.1.2 Linux系统下网格环境的配置
  • 3.2 GSI认证授权与代理
  • 3.3 单点登录与角色映射
  • 3.4 异构平台互操作
  • 3.5 本章小结
  • 4 Globus Toolkit 4多资源工厂模式网格服务研究
  • 4.1 Globus Toolkit 4中的单资源多资源模式服务
  • 4.1.1 单资源模式服务
  • 4.1.2 多资源工厂模式服务
  • 4.2 多资源工厂模式网格服务实现
  • 4.2.1 定义服务接口
  • 4.2.2 服务实现
  • 4.2.3 建立服务配置部署文件
  • 4.2.4 编译生成GAR文件
  • 4.2.5 部署服务
  • 4.2.6 创建客户端程序并测试系统运行结果
  • 4.3 本章小结
  • 5 基于Globus Toolkit 4的股票报价网格服务实现
  • 5.1 引言
  • 5.2 股票报价网格服务应用系统
  • 5.3 股票报价网格服务系统实现
  • 5.3.1 网络结构
  • 5.3.2 实现环境
  • 5.3.3 实现过程
  • 5.4 股票报价网格服务应用
  • 5.5 本章小结
  • 6 总结与展望
  • 6.1 论文的主要研究工作总结
  • 6.2 应用拓展与展望
  • 致谢
  • 参考文献
  • 附录A 股票报价网格服务客户端图形化程序
  • 附录B 攻读硕士学位期间参与的项目与发表的论文
  • 相关论文文献

    • [1].网格开发工具Globus Toolkit 4的安装与配置[J]. 农业网络信息 2010(10)
    • [2].系统开发中Ajax Control Toolkit的应用[J]. 电脑编程技巧与维护 2009(09)
    • [3].基于Globus Toolkit4的网格服务的实现[J]. 计算机与现代化 2008(09)
    • [4].Simulation Toolkit模拟技术在网络管理课程教学中的应用[J]. 硅谷 2010(13)
    • [5].RDA Toolkit使用的利弊分析[J]. 图书馆杂志 2012(12)
    • [6].ArchestrA DAServer Toolkit原理与应用开发流程[J]. 工业控制计算机 2019(09)
    • [7].PhysiolComp Toolkit:一个生理计算交互工具箱的分析与设计[J]. 计算机学报 2015(12)
    • [8].应用Pro/TOOLKIT实现铁心三维建模[J]. 变压器 2010(09)
    • [9].Pro/TOOLKIT技术二次开发的基本方法的研究[J]. 科技信息(学术研究) 2008(08)
    • [10].基于Pro/TOOLKIT的产品工艺性分析系统研究[J]. 机械工程师 2011(10)
    • [11].基于Pro/TOOLKIT的参数化设计方法研究[J]. 机械工程师 2009(08)
    • [12].Pro/Toolkit工程制图功能开发方法[J]. 制造技术与机床 2008(11)
    • [13].利用LabVIEW SQL Toolkit对不同类型数据存取操作的方法研究[J]. 测控技术 2014(09)
    • [14].基于NeOn Toolkit的本体重用方法实例研究[J]. 图书与情报 2013(01)
    • [15].RDA Toolkit的功能及使用方法解析[J]. 图书馆建设 2012(09)
    • [16].基于Pro/Toolkit的逆变器箱体参数化设计[J]. 西安工程大学学报 2017(05)
    • [17].基于Pro/Toolkit的伸缩吊臂参数化设计[J]. 机械工程与自动化 2015(05)
    • [18].Pro/Toolkit快速开发方法研究[J]. 信息技术 2014(10)
    • [19].基于Pro/Toolkit的法兰参数化系统设计[J]. 机械与电子 2010(08)
    • [20].基于Pro/Toolkit的工程绘图系统的开发[J]. 机械工程与自动化 2008(01)
    • [21].面向再制造的基于Pro/Toolkit的拆卸仿真[J]. 机械设计与制造 2012(05)
    • [22].从RDA Toolkit的发布看未来资源描述与检索[J]. 现代情报 2011(07)
    • [23].基于Pro/TOOLKIT的点坐标测量工具的开发[J]. 组合机床与自动化加工技术 2010(08)
    • [24].基于Pro/Toolkit的装配仿真技术研究[J]. 中国制造业信息化 2008(01)
    • [25].基于Pro/TOOLKIT异步模式的渐开线齿轮库系统设计[J]. 组合机床与自动化加工技术 2008(11)
    • [26].基于WindChill/PDMLink零件调用的关键技术[J]. 机械设计与制造工程 2015(01)
    • [27].RDA Toolkit与印刷型连续出版物编目探析[J]. 图书馆杂志 2012(08)
    • [28].《The 5.1 Audio Toolkit》 多用途影院系统调校DVD[J]. 家庭影院技术 2009(02)
    • [29].Visualization Toolkit软件在医学图像三维可视化中的应用[J]. 中国组织工程研究与临床康复 2009(26)
    • [30].基于Pro/TOOLKIT二次开发的高效构建组件[J]. 计算机应用与软件 2008(04)

    标签:;  ;  ;  

    基于Globus Toolkit 4的网格服务研究开发
    下载Doc文档

    猜你喜欢